Advantages of West Coast E-commerce Warehouses

Proximity to Major Consumer Markets

The West Coast offers proximity to major markets like Los Angeles, San Francisco, and Seattle. This location advantage allows for significantly reduced shipping times and costs.

Fast and Cost-effective Shipping

West Coast warehouses can improve delivery speeds across the Pacific region, enabling better customer satisfaction. Costs associated with long transportation routes are also minimized, providing a stronger bottom line for businesses.

Advanced Technologies in Modern Warehouses

IoT and Automation

Cutting-edge technologies like IoT and automation are prevalent in West Coast warehouses, resulting in efficient inventory management and picking processes.

Example of Automation Impact

Using automated warehouse systems, some businesses report a 30% reduction in order processing times—directly impacting customer satisfaction and operational efficiency.

How Sustainable Practices Benefit E-commerce

Green Warehousing

West Coast warehouses increasingly adopt eco-friendly practices, aligning with consumer demand for sustainability. Renewable energy, waste reduction, and sustainable materials usage are key features of these warehouses.

Environmental Advantages

Businesses can enhance their brand image by supporting sustainability, an ever-growing consumer priority. Equally, these practices can reduce energy expenses, providing an economic advantage.

Latest Developments

As of September 2023, notable developments include the expansion of Amazon’s robotics initiatives across its West Coast distribution centers. This expansion aims to enhance worker safety and operational efficiency, setting a benchmark in the industry.
